    What to do if my Roadstar MP-415 earphones can not hear the voice?
    • B
      bakerjonathanAug 10, 2025
      If you cannot hear any sound through your earphones, first, verify that the volume is not set to 0. If the volume is at an audible level, inspect the earphone connection to ensure it is properly connected.

    Why Roadstar MP-415 MP3 Player can not download or failure during data transmission?
    • S
      Scott DawsonAug 20, 2025
      If you are experiencing issues with downloading or data transmission, ensure a successful connection between your PC and the player. Also, verify that the device is recognized, that the device is formatted, and that there is enough memory available.
